- "Join us for a delightful culinary journey as we share our unforgettable family dinner experience at Nyonya Willow restaurant, nestled in the heart of Arena Curve Bayan Lepas, Penang. Our gracious friends from Singapore treated us to an evening of exquisite Nyonya cuisine, and what a treat it was!
Nyonya Willow is renowned for its authentic homecooked style Nyonya dishes, and from the first bite, we were enchanted by the rich flavors and tantalizing aromas that filled the air. Each dish was a masterpiece, expertly crafted to perfection. From the aromatic spices to the fresh ingredients, every element came together harmoniously to create a symphony of flavors.
As we savored each mouthwatering bite, we couldn't help but appreciate the care and passion that went into preparing these culinary delights. From the iconic Nyonya Assam Pedas stingray fish to the flavorful Hong Bak and kiam chye boay, every dish left us craving for more. The kids loved the fragrant inchi kabin fried chicken and assam prawns!
Set against the backdrop of warm hospitality and charming ambiance, our dining experience at Nyonya Willow was nothing short of magical. It's no wonder this gem of a restaurant has captured the hearts of locals and visitors alike.
